What is the direct object in the sentence?

Logan studied rocketry in science class.

A.
rocketry

B.
science

C.
class

D.
studied

Respuesta :

metchelle
metchelle metchelle
  • 03-06-2016
A direct object is a word or word phrase that receives the action done by the subject. It usually answers the question "what?". In the sentence, "Logan studied rocketry in science class", the direct object in this sentence is the word "rocketry". It clearly answers the question, "What did Logan study in science class?". So the answer is letter A.
